Tsuneyasu Miyamoto (宮本 恒靖, Miyamoto Tsuneyasu, born February 7, 1977 in Osaka) is a retired Japanese footballer who was active from 1995 until 2011.A central defender, Miyamoto went on to make 71 international appearances and led the Japan national team in the 2002 and 2006 World Cups as well as the 2004 Asian Cup. Miyamoto also captained Gamba Osaka during their 2005 J. League championship season.He is also a graduate of the 13th edition of FIFA Master.
